zoukankan      html  css  js  c++  java
  • DedeCMS调用多说评论系统遇到的一些问题

    最近前端笔记加入了多说的评论,因为自带的评论太渣了。过程不是很顺利,把遇到的问题和大家分享下。我用的dedecms,所以使用的是dede的多说评论模块。效果图:

        多说官方下载:http://dev.duoshuo.com/dedecms

        先说一下这个评论的优点吧:

        1、适配了多个博客系统,各种WP、DEDE、Python等等;

        2、安装简单,有教程

        3、可以绑定各大社交账号

        4、评论可以分享到各大绑定账号

        5、SEO友好

        经过考虑,w3cmark就使用了多说的评论了。

        

        下面主要说说遇到的问题:

        1、css加载比结构慢了一步,所以刚开始加载出结构的时候,评论的没有样式的,体验很不好

        

        因为整个评论是经过embed.js封装,所以样式也是在js里面请求的。目前想到解决的方法是在页面首先引入他默认的css,http://static.duoshuo.com/styles/embed.default.css,当js加载时再请求同样的css,浏览器已经加载了。

        2、如何删除已经添加的多说站点?

        以绑定新浪微博为栗子,当你用微博绑定后,进入多说官网--点击顶部的后台管理--工具——删除站点 即可。

        

        3、如何添加多说的新站点(只是DEDE下的)

        删除不是重点,重点是怎么添加一个多说站点。因为添加出现在第一次安装成功的时候,而多说后台是没有添加站点的。我同一个微博,备案前绑定过一次,昨天安装后又新加了多说站点。但是安装后出现分享的链接都是以前站点久的链接(备案换了国内的空间),结果找不到设置站点域名的地方(⊙_⊙)?(后来才发现,是在安装成功后新建多说站点的时候设置的。)

        以为是安装设置问题,所以就把多说模块,删了重装,删了重装,但是一直没出现添加多说站点的界面!!所以就决定进多说后台管理把站点给删了,谁知道找了很久也没找到地方添加回来!!

        原来安装一次模块后,会在DEDE后台的 系统——系统设置——系统基本参数——模块设置 里面是会有相应的参数的,如图:

        

        如果这里的参数存在,就认定你的系统已经安装过多说了,无论你在模块里面怎么删除、重装都是不会在安装成功后显示添加多说站点的。所以方法就是在系统参数设置吧多说的二级域名和密钥删了。然后再在DEDE后台的模块里面重装多说评论模块。安装成功后就可以设置多说站点,和你博客的域名了。

        

        这里一定要核对正确,否则后面是无法修改的,需要安装上面的步骤重装才行,这个地址是分享评论的引用的地址。

        官方安装教程 http://dev.duoshuo.com/threads/5010ad8a0543c8562e000007

  • 相关阅读:
    Logback日志格式配置相关记录
    前后端分离验证码之cookie+redis方案
    聊一聊Swagger ui登录功能实现方案
    nginx-thinkphp5
    jmeter常用的性能测试监听器
    jvm内存
    TCP连接状态详解
    原生Javascript实现图片轮播效果
    适用于CSS2的各种运动的javascript运动框架
    JS中for循环里面的闭包问题的原因及解决办法
  • 原文地址:https://www.cnblogs.com/ljack/p/4114834.html
Copyright © 2011-2022 走看看